pkgsrc-Changes-HG archive
[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index][Old Index]
[pkgsrc/trunk]: pkgsrc/archivers/lzmalib Import lzmalib-0.0.1 as archivers/lz...
details: https://anonhg.NetBSD.org/pkgsrc/rev/aae3346178dc
branches: trunk
changeset: 546538:aae3346178dc
user: obache <obache%pkgsrc.org@localhost>
date: Thu Sep 04 12:07:15 2008 +0000
description:
Import lzmalib-0.0.1 as archivers/lzmalib.
This package includes a thin wrapper library of LZMA SDK written
by Igor Pavlov.
diffstat:
archivers/lzmalib/DESCR | 2 ++
archivers/lzmalib/Makefile | 21 +++++++++++++++++++++
archivers/lzmalib/PLIST | 7 +++++++
archivers/lzmalib/buildlink3.mk | 19 +++++++++++++++++++
archivers/lzmalib/distinfo | 6 ++++++
archivers/lzmalib/patches/patch-aa | 24 ++++++++++++++++++++++++
6 files changed, 79 insertions(+), 0 deletions(-)
diffs (103 lines):
diff -r 1387ea4c246d -r aae3346178dc archivers/lzmalib/DESCR
--- /dev/null Thu Jan 01 00:00:00 1970 +0000
+++ b/archivers/lzmalib/DESCR Thu Sep 04 12:07:15 2008 +0000
@@ -0,0 +1,2 @@
+This package includes a thin wrapper library of LZMA SDK written
+by Igor Pavlov.
diff -r 1387ea4c246d -r aae3346178dc archivers/lzmalib/Makefile
--- /dev/null Thu Jan 01 00:00:00 1970 +0000
+++ b/archivers/lzmalib/Makefile Thu Sep 04 12:07:15 2008 +0000
@@ -0,0 +1,21 @@
+# $NetBSD: Makefile,v 1.1.1.1 2008/09/04 12:07:15 obache Exp $
+#
+
+DISTNAME= lzmalib-0.0.1
+CATEGORIES= archivers
+MASTER_SITES= http://tokyocabinet.sourceforge.net/misc/
+
+MAINTAINER= obache%NetBSD.org@localhost
+HOMEPAGE= http://tokyocabinet.sourceforge.net/misc/
+COMMENT= Thin wrapper library of LZMA
+
+PKG_DESTDIR_SUPPORT= user-destdir
+
+GNU_CONFIGURE= yes
+USE_LANGUAGES= c c++
+USE_TOOLS+= gmake
+
+# Link with c++ instead (see also patch-aa)
+CONFIGURE_ENV+= ac_cv_lib_stdcpp_main=no
+
+.include "../../mk/bsd.pkg.mk"
diff -r 1387ea4c246d -r aae3346178dc archivers/lzmalib/PLIST
--- /dev/null Thu Jan 01 00:00:00 1970 +0000
+++ b/archivers/lzmalib/PLIST Thu Sep 04 12:07:15 2008 +0000
@@ -0,0 +1,7 @@
+@comment $NetBSD: PLIST,v 1.1.1.1 2008/09/04 12:07:15 obache Exp $
+bin/lzmacmd
+include/lzmalib.h
+lib/liblzma.a
+lib/liblzma.so
+lib/liblzma.so.1
+lib/liblzma.so.1.1.0
diff -r 1387ea4c246d -r aae3346178dc archivers/lzmalib/buildlink3.mk
--- /dev/null Thu Jan 01 00:00:00 1970 +0000
+++ b/archivers/lzmalib/buildlink3.mk Thu Sep 04 12:07:15 2008 +0000
@@ -0,0 +1,19 @@
+# $NetBSD: buildlink3.mk,v 1.1.1.1 2008/09/04 12:07:15 obache Exp $
+
+BUILDLINK_DEPTH:= ${BUILDLINK_DEPTH}+
+LZMALIB_BUILDLINK3_MK:= ${LZMALIB_BUILDLINK3_MK}+
+
+.if ${BUILDLINK_DEPTH} == "+"
+BUILDLINK_DEPENDS+= lzmalib
+.endif
+
+BUILDLINK_PACKAGES:= ${BUILDLINK_PACKAGES:Nlzmalib}
+BUILDLINK_PACKAGES+= lzmalib
+BUILDLINK_ORDER:= ${BUILDLINK_ORDER} ${BUILDLINK_DEPTH}lzmalib
+
+.if ${LZMALIB_BUILDLINK3_MK} == "+"
+BUILDLINK_API_DEPENDS.lzmalib+= lzmalib>=0.0.1
+BUILDLINK_PKGSRCDIR.lzmalib?= ../../archivers/lzmalib
+.endif # LZMALIB_BUILDLINK3_MK
+
+BUILDLINK_DEPTH:= ${BUILDLINK_DEPTH:S/+$//}
diff -r 1387ea4c246d -r aae3346178dc archivers/lzmalib/distinfo
--- /dev/null Thu Jan 01 00:00:00 1970 +0000
+++ b/archivers/lzmalib/distinfo Thu Sep 04 12:07:15 2008 +0000
@@ -0,0 +1,6 @@
+$NetBSD: distinfo,v 1.1.1.1 2008/09/04 12:07:15 obache Exp $
+
+SHA1 (lzmalib-0.0.1.tar.gz) = 638e511d1c6c5018f071b0f145bdfb242c34b6ce
+RMD160 (lzmalib-0.0.1.tar.gz) = caad5a009f3247ee1d0ee1500b90db5469ce1bd4
+Size (lzmalib-0.0.1.tar.gz) = 112202 bytes
+SHA1 (patch-aa) = 475d43320384887faf6d14c13d2f7b941327299e
diff -r 1387ea4c246d -r aae3346178dc archivers/lzmalib/patches/patch-aa
--- /dev/null Thu Jan 01 00:00:00 1970 +0000
+++ b/archivers/lzmalib/patches/patch-aa Thu Sep 04 12:07:15 2008 +0000
@@ -0,0 +1,24 @@
+$NetBSD: patch-aa,v 1.1.1.1 2008/09/04 12:07:15 obache Exp $
+
+Link with c++ instead of cc -lstdc++ to depended package easy to link.
+
+--- Makefile.in.orig 2008-07-23 08:40:09.000000000 +0000
++++ Makefile.in
+@@ -125,7 +125,7 @@ liblzma.a : $(LIBOBJFILES)
+
+
+ liblzma.so.$(LIBVER).$(LIBREV).0 : $(LIBOBJFILES)
+- $(CC) -shared -Wl,-soname,liblzma.so.$(LIBVER) -o $@ $(LIBOBJFILES) \
++ $(CXX) -shared -Wl,-soname,liblzma.so.$(LIBVER) -o $@ $(LIBOBJFILES) \
+ $(LDFLAGS) $(LIBS)
+
+
+@@ -138,7 +138,7 @@ liblzma.so : liblzma.so.$(LIBVER).$(LIBR
+
+
+ liblzma.$(LIBVER).$(LIBREV).0.dylib : $(LIBOBJFILES)
+- $(CC) -dynamiclib -o $@ \
++ $(CXX) -dynamiclib -o $@ \
+ -install_name $(LIBDIR)/liblzma.$(LIBVER).dylib \
+ -current_version $(LIBVER).$(LIBREV).0 -compatibility_version $(LIBVER) \
+ $(LIBOBJFILES) $(LDFLAGS) $(LIBS)
Home |
Main Index |
Thread Index |
Old Index